This is not GTA.
You cannot exit your car and drop objects in the road. So , there's no "realistic" system yet. Remember its a racing simulator, whatever you want to do as extra is not the dev,s problem.
In some simulators you dont even have objects, so...
As said before, lets complain everytime instead of searching the good points of the game.